Grapical EPG, Change timer, Delete hot key is green should be red.

In the Graphical EPG, existing timers are highlighted. Navigating to them allow the option to "Change timer" ( subject to bug #174 )

Pressing the Green button pops a mini menu with (Green)Delete Timer and (Blue)Edit Timer.

To match the rest of the UI the Delete Timer hot key should be the Red button.

Reproduction steps

  1. Enter the Graphical EPG.
  2. Select a program.
  3. Add a timer for it.
  4. Re-select the same program.
  5. Press Green "Change Timer"
  6. The mini menu has (Green)Delete Timer and (Blue)Edit Timer.
